Early church•c. AD 33–36
Paul’s conversion
Saul encounters the risen Jesus on the road to Damascus and is commissioned as a witness who will carry the Gospel to the nations.

Historical context
The earliest Jesus movement was still closely connected to Jewish communities and Scripture, while travel between cities, synagogues, and Roman administrative centers created pathways for both opposition and mission.
Biblical significance
Paul’s transformation displays the risen Jesus’ authority and the surprising reach of grace. Acts uses the event to explain the calling of a former persecutor as a missionary and witness among Jews and Gentiles.
